Transaction 1051686d8df7124d5b28f100c326d7051d7716c0c5af10569bd38b8f9c855b41

2 Input
2 Outputs
  • 1051686d8df7124d5b28f100c326d7051d7716c0c5af10569bd38b8f9c855b41:0
  • value  125513
    address  36WRWNVSfbtGjHfz1R84i9WEUeJBY3Pg2e
  • 1051686d8df7124d5b28f100c326d7051d7716c0c5af10569bd38b8f9c855b41:1
  • value  4126031
    address  1A7ibNDadYxS2UiUWyT3aenvBqvFSpDxQd